LATROBE CRICKET CLUB team
Sunday League/3rds
Coach :
Shane Wootton
Woot is a member of Sheffield Cricket Club's Team of the Half-Century, a former CNW Representative Team Coach and CNW Board Member. A highly-competitive former all-rounder with the Mountaineers, Wootton enters his second year at the helm of Latrobe Cricket Club. Last season he was able to unearth some new A-Grade players and no doubt will be looking for the club to make its mark with the same steely resolve he was known for throughout his career.
Captain :
Josh Gadsby
RH Batsman, RA Off Spin. LCC Career Stats: 125 matches, 40 catches. 1225 runs @ 9.57, HS 63 not out. 22 wickets @ 31.64, BB 4-22. After the elation of performing well in an A-Reserve Premiership season in 2007/08, Gadsby had an up and down season in 2008/09. On occasions he struck the ball very well, making a career-best 63 not out in Sunday League and leading this team to the Grand Final. Too often though he made a start and got out due to a rush of blood. Gadsby has worked incredibly hard on his game and now has the tools to be an effective turf cricketer, it is up to him to play to his strengths and grind out some big innings. An in-form Gadsby is an important cog in the 2nd Grade team, and good performances there could lead to higher honours.
Vice Captain :
Ben Dick
RH Batsman, Wicket-Keeper. LCC Career Stats: 54 matches, 41 catches, 6 stumpings. 1211 runs @ 21.62, HS 86. Dicky is a tall, powerful batsman with a wide range of attacking strokes, while also an accomplished keeper. He really started to strike some good form in the last half of last season, particularly in Sunday League. Unfortunately he couldn't compile a big score in 2nd Grade, finding ways to get out even though he looked in good touch. Dicky is now an experienced player with the club and is looked up to by his team-mates because of his community involvement and friendly nature. There is no doubt Dicky will kick on this year and look to cement a strong 2nd Grade position.
Players
Tony Aherne
RH Batsman, RA Medium-Fast. LCC Career Stats: 36 matches, 9 catches. 384 runs @ 13.71, HS 71*. 29 wickets @ 24.48, BB 3-27. Tony is a gifted all-rounder who was starved of opportunities last season but, as Sunday League Bowling award (and nearly Batting award) winner in 2007/08, he could not cement a regular place in the batting or bowling line-ups. Tony is a medium-pace bowler who can get the ball to rise off a good length, and with the bat hits the ball straight and hard. He also has a very strong throwing arm and batsmen need to be wary. The key to Tony having a positive season in 2009/10 will be concentration on improving his consistency and technique, along with acting on the advice of his coaches. Should he do this, Tony has a bright future.
Callum Butler
Kodie Clarke
RH Batsman, RA Medium. LCC Career Stats: 60 matches, 13 catches. 289 runs @ 6.72, HS 25. 34 wickets @ 13.79, BB 5-15. Kodie was a massive improver last season, going from a fringe Sunday League player to performing well in several 2nd Grade games. He is a deceptive medium-pacer, able to move the ball around and was particularly effective as a "death" bowler in one-day matches. With the bat Kodie's technique and footwork continues to improve, and he made his highest score in the Sunday League Grand Final of last season. With greater self-belief Kodie should perform even better this season and cement a place in the 2nd Grad side.
Matt Clarke
RH Batsman, Wicket-Keeper. LCC Career Stats: 98 matches, 77 catches, 6 stumpings. 1560 runs @ 18.14, HS 97. 14 wickets @ 27.50, BB 4-40. Clarke has played plenty of cricket for someone who is still only 19. He is a talented top/middle-order batsman able to play shots on either side of the wicket and is a great judge of a quick single. A fantastic athlete, Clarke is equally as comfortable in the field as he is behind the stumps. A young player with a great feel for the game, Clarke is a future leader at Latrobe and will be looking to build on the improved form with the bat that he demonstrated at the end of last season.
Selwyn Deverell
RH Batsman, RA Fast-Medium. Selwyn has recently joined the club. As an experienced cricketer we welcome him with open arms and wish him well for the season.
Trent Donohue
RH Batsman, RA Off-spin. LCC Career Stats: 53 matches, 11 catches. 379 runs @ 9.97, HS 42 not out. 52 wickets @ 11.48, BB 5-11. Donohue rejoined the club in the second half of last season, becoming a key player in the Sunday League side. His off-spin bowling is deadly accurate and he possesses a good arm ball, surprising Devonport by opening the bowling in the Sunday League Grand Final. In the field he has a good pair of hands and can score quick runs in the middle-to-late order batting positions. With increased opportunity and training Donohue will make an even bigger impression this season.
Greg Edwards
Grant Evans
Brandon Goss
RH Batsman, RA Medium.
LCC Career Stats: 37 matches, 22 catches.
589 runs @ 18.41, HS 50 not out.
28 wickets @ 15.46, BB 4-13.
Gossy has spent a couple of seasons in the Junior Colts team and established himself as a highly accomplished all-rounder. He has always had attacking flair as a batsman, but last season really started to tighten up defensively and is increasingly difficult to dismiss. With the ball Gossy is a consistent medium-pacer and can be relied upon to do a job for his captain. Now too old for Junior Colts, the challenge this year is for Goss to break into a strong 2nd Grade team and make the most of his opportunities. I'm backing this young man to be a big improver this season.
Grant Goss
RH Batsman; RA Medium.
Father of Brandon, Grant has elected to take the field this year to play some matches with his son. Good luck Gossy!
Tony Hays
Shayne Keep
RH Batsman; RA Off-Spin. LCC Career Stats: 9 matches, 3 catches. 147 runs @ 21.00, HS 48. 10 wickets @21.50, BB 2-19.
Club President Shayne Keep is donning the whites again this season to help increase the experience of our Sunday League side. He offers skills in both batting and bowling that will help the team remain competitive. Good luck Shaymo!
Matthew Nicolle
LH Batsman, RA Slow-Medium. LCC Career Stats: 88 matches, 76 catches, 14 stumpings. 1364 runs @ 17.27, HS 78. 7 wickets @ 23.57, BB 2-22. Foo returned to the field last season after nearly a decade away and was an important player in the middle and late-season improvements in the club's batting. A determined batsman who puts great pride in his wicket, Nicolle worked well with his younger team-mates and was a part of several key partnerships. If you asked Foo he would say he was under-bowled, but a man of his immense talent with the ball is best used as a partnership-breaker. This season Nicolle will be looking to be a rock in the batting line-up and once again set the example for his younger team-mates.
Ray Read
LH Batsman; Wicket-Keeper. LCC A-Grade Player 123.
Ray was a member of last year's Tasmanian Over-60's team and is a life member of Latrobe Cricket Club. A doggedly determined left-hand batsman and skillful wicket-keeper, Ray is keen to play a few Sunday League matches to aid in his preparation for another shot at Tasmanian Over-60's representation. Good luck Ray!
Scott Read
LH Batsman; Wicket-Keeper. LCC Career Stats: 58 matches, 56 catches, 14 stumpings. 913 runs @ 14.27, HS 96. 1 wicket @ 16.00, BB 1-10.
Scooter returns to Latrobe this season having returned to the area after working in Hobart for two years. He is an aggressive top-order batsman known to punish anything short or wide, and an excellent keeper, particularly when standing up to the stumps. There is no doubt Scooter will help to stabilise the top order in 2nd Grade, and may even push for 1st Grade honours again.
Garry Reeves
Josh Squibb
RH Batsman, RA Fast-Medium. LCC Career Stats: 42 matches, 7 catches. 158 runs @ 6.58, HS 24. 23 wickets @ 25.09, BB 3-25. I don't mean to brag but this time last year I tipped Josh to be the big improver of the season, and I was right! Squibb (son of David) emerged as new-ball bowler and hard-hitting lower-order batsman in 2nd Grade, his good performances earning him a place in 2nd Grade's Semi-Final team. A tall young man, Squibb regularly hits the seam, able to get the ball to jump and cut batsmen in half with prodigious swing. As he fills out Josh will get more pace and consistency from his action - batsmen beware! With application to following the advice of his coaches and further improving his technique with bat and ball Josh has another good year ahead.
Sam Squibb
LH Batsman, RA Off-spin, Wicket-Keeper. LCC Career Stats: 30 matches, 6 catches, 1 stumping. 98 runs @ 5.76, HS 24. 3 wickets @ 13.00, BB 2-18. Despite being only 13, Squibb (son of David) has been around the club for a long time. He is a talented all-round cricketer, being a developing batsman, good wicket-keeper and accomplished fieldsman. With several players unavailable for 2nd Grade on occasions, he got a taste of 2nd Grade and quickly demonstrated he had no fear, getting in behind the ball when batting and playing his part in lower-order partnerships. He also got invaluable experience by playing in the Sunday League team regularly, including the Grand Final. Sam should now be looking to establish himself at the top of the order in Junior Colts/Sunday League, bat as often and for as long as he can, and surely this determined young man will have a great year.
